One of the UAB kids is going to IU. It's Marqui Hawkins. He was originally a 4 star recruit and went to Florida out of high school. He transferred to UAB when Florida moved him to safety. He redshirted this last year at UAB and is immediately eligible at IU. His teammate, Jordan Howard who ran for 1600 yards last season is still in play for IU.

DRiccio21 wrote:he just punted.

he isn't as wild and unorthodox as i think we feel some guys should be, but he certainly takes more chances than most do
They won't get the ball back. It is like Gruden and the Redskins two weeks ago.

In my reading over the years, I believe in three core elements of offensive football.

1. The first three quarters are nothing more than point-maximization games. You got for the MOST points possible at all times; touchdowns over field goals when applicable and ALWAYS go for two.

2. You make the decision to go for it on fourth down a lot before the game/season/career. It is not an individual decision. When you get into the mode of doing it, you will change the football game (i.e. 3rd-and-seven is no longer only a passing down)

3. The better the other team's offense, the more aggressive you get. Great offenses don't give a shit if they start the drive at their own 25 or at midfield. Punt to shitty offenses.
